Malaysian airline announces: After receiving approval from the Civil Aviation Authority, a new Malaysian airline has announced that it will begin operating flights to Pakistan.
The announcement by AirAsia Airlines that it will begin operating flights to Karachi in May 2025, together with the Civil Aviation Authority’s approval for AirAsia’s flight operations, is good news for Pakistan’s aviation industry, according to Express News.
AirAsia is starting flights to Karachi from May 30, initially the airline will operate four flights weekly between Karachi and Kuala Lumpur. This is a new milestone in the international network expansion of AirAsia Airlines, the arrival of a new foreign airline will create job opportunities in Pakistan.
AirAsia operates flights on a total of 22 routes and is the only low-cost airline in Malaysia to provide direct service to Karachi. Aviation experts say that this new route will increase cheap connectivity between the two countries.
